Inoue Kamaboko

Wadazuka / Kamakura Station area, Kamakura

Inoue Kamaboko hand-forms fish paste into kamaboko, hanpen and koban-age using whole fish selected for the Kamakura trade, a craft the shop calls the daiginjo of fish. It sells directly from its own storefronts near Kamakura Station rather than through department-store counters.

Best for — Fresh kamaboko fish cake
